Main Meaning & Full Form
At its core, the “dtf meaning slang” stands for Down To F*ck. It’s a bold and direct acronym used to indicate someone’s willingness to engage in casual sexual activity or a short-term physical relationship . Think of it as a high-signal, low-effort way to communicate openness to a hookup without having to spell it all out in a long, awkward message.
When someone says they are “DTF,” they are essentially saying they’re down (meaning willing or ready) to have sex. This term is heavily associated with hookup culture and is often used to gauge interest without the pretense of a long-term romantic commitment .
Key Takeaway: The “dtf full form” is “Down To F*ck.” However, depending on the context, it can also be used humorously to stand for things like “Down To Fish” or “Down To Frisbee,” but these are playful exceptions that prove the rule.
Different Possible Meanings (Context-wise)
While the primary “dtf slang” meaning is sexual, the acronym can stand for other things depending on who you’re talking to. It’s crucial to “read the room” to avoid a major misunderstanding.
Here is a breakdown of the different contexts in which you might see “DTF”:
1. The Slang Meaning (Most Common)
This is the one you need to know. In texts, DMs, and dating apps, “DTF” means Down To F*ck. It signals a desire for a casual physical encounter without emotional attachments .
2. The Professional/Technical Meaning
In the world of business and printing, “DTF” stands for Direct-to-Film. It’s a printing method used to transfer designs onto fabrics . If you’re talking to a graphic designer or someone in the apparel industry, they probably aren’t hitting on you—they’re talking about t-shirts.
3. The Humorous/Alternative Meaning
Younger crowds and internet culture love to subvert the original meaning. You might see people using DTF to mean:
-
Down To Fish (for fishing enthusiasts)
-
Down To Fellowship (for church groups)
-
Din Tai Fung (for fans of the famous restaurant chain) .

Origin & History
Where did this edgy acronym come from? The “dtf meaning slang” has been percolating in American pop culture for a while. The term “down to fuck” existed in spoken language for decades, but it wasn’t until the early 2000s that it became the viral acronym we know today.
-
Early 2000s (The Internet Age): The first definitions of DTF appeared on Urban Dictionary around 2002 . As texting and instant messaging exploded, people needed faster ways to type common phrases.
-
Pop Culture Explosion: The acronym got a massive boost in the late 2000s and early 2010s. It was featured in the movie Superbad (2007) and was heavily popularized by the cast of the reality TV show Jersey Shore . Pauly D and the gang used it so often that it became embedded in the cultural lexicon.
-
Music Influence: Big Pun’s 1998 song “Still Not A Player” famously asked, “Who’s down to fuck tonight?” . This lyrical usage helped bridge the gap between street slang and mainstream media.

India vs USA Usage (Regional Differences)
The “dtf meaning slang” is predominantly an American export, but it has firmly established itself in Indian Tier 1 and Tier 2 cities, albeit with nuances.
-
In the USA: DTF is used casually and openly. It’s practically a standard question on apps like Tinder or Bumble. People are direct; if they are DTF, they will usually say it without beating around the bush .
-
In India (Tier 1/2 Cities): The usage exists but is often more nuanced. Young Indians on dating apps might use it, but it’s often filtered through “Hinglish” or contextual slang. Because of the broader cultural spectrum, using the term is generally seen as “bold” or “forward.” People might use it in private WhatsApp chats but would never mention it on Instagram or Facebook where family could see it. It’s also common for Indians to joke about it via memes.
-
Example (Hinglish): “Bro, she’s definitely DTF tonight, plan pakka hai.” (Bro, she’s definitely interested in hooking up tonight, the plan is confirmed).

DTF Meaning from a Girl vs Guy
Does the “dtf meaning slang” change based on who’s saying it? Yes and no.
-
The definition remains the same: For both guys and girls, it means “Down To F*ck.”
-
The social perception differs: When a guy says “DTF,” it is often seen as the status quo of male behavior. When a girl says “DTF,” it might be viewed as more “forward” or “empowering” (or sometimes unfairly judged due to lingering societal double standards).
-
For Girls: Using “DTF” is a way to take charge of one’s sexuality and state intentions clearly without playing “hard to get.”
-
For Guys: Using “DTF” can be risky. It can come off as aggressive or predatory if not used in a receptive context. It is best used when there is already a high level of flirtation.
